The EHV (Extra-High Voltage) Cable Accessories Market, by product type, encompasses critical components designed to ensure reliable high-voltage transmission. Terminations are essential for safely connecting cables to transformers, switchgear, and other equipment, with increasing deployment in renewable energy grids driving demand. Jointing kits facilitate seamless cable connections over long distances, supporting the expanding transmission infrastructure in emerging economies. Shields provide insulation and protection, enhancing operational safety and extending cable lifespan, especially in urban and industrial installations. The EHV (Extra-High Voltage) Cable Accessories Market, segmented by insulation material, reflects the growing demand for reliable and durable high-voltage transmission systems. XLPE (Cross-Linked Polyethylene) insulation dominates due to its superior thermal performance, chemical resistance, and lower dielectric losses, accounting for a significant share of the market. PVC (Polyvinyl Chloride) insulation is widely used in medium to high-voltage applications owing to its cost-effectiveness and flame-retardant properties. Oil-Impregnated Paper (OIP) insulation remains relevant in legacy systems, especially in regions with established infrastructure, representing a niche yet steady segment.
